Digital Currency Shift: A Global Paradigm

As the world continues to grapple with technological advancements and economic shifts, digital currencies have emerged as a frontier of both opportunity and debate. Governments, businesses, and consumers are all facing the challenge of adapting to the new financial ecosystem that digital currencies promise to bring.

The year 2025 marks a significant period where digital currencies are not just theoretical concepts but real instruments of exchange and economic strategy. Countries like the United States, China, and several European nations are implementing various strategies to regulate, adopt, and in some cases, resist the full integration of digital currencies into their economies.

In the U.S., the Federal Reserve has intensified its exploration of a digital dollar, a move that could potentially redefine financial transactions and monetary policy. Meanwhile, China's digital yuan continues to expand in influence, paralleling the nation's growing economic footprint globally. The competition between these two giants highlights the strategic underpinnings of digital currencies beyond mere commerce—they are tools of geopolitical leverage.

The corporate world is also adapting swiftly. Tech giants and traditional financial institutions are racing to incorporate blockchain technology to streamline operations and cut costs. Innovations in financial services, such as dec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ms, are challenging the status quo and offering consumers alternatives to traditional banking.

However, this rapid adoption is not without its challenges. There are significant concerns over privacy, security, and the environmental impact of large-scale digital currency mining operations. Experts are urging comprehensive regulations to safeguard against potential disruptions and the misuse of these technologies.

Furthermore, the digital currency boom has also stimulated a cultural shift. Younger generations are increasingly viewing digital currencies as viable alternatives to conventional investments, influencing trends in wealth management and consumer behavior. This shift is evident not just in the Western world but globally, as seen in the increased use of digital wallets in countries across Africa and Southeast Asia, offering financial inclusion to those previously unbanked.

As digital currencies continue to evolve, the world anticipates shifts in international trade, monetary policy, and cross-border financial interactions. Stakeholders worldwide will need to navigate this dynamic landscape, balancing innovation with regulation and growth with sustainability.

The global economy is at a crossroads, with digital currencies at the center of transformative change, making it crucial for individuals and institutions alike to stay informed and adaptable to the changes that lie ahead.
